About Benoı̂t Navez
Benoı̂t Navez is a scholar working on Emergency Medicine,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Gastroenterology and Oncology, having authored 57 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Appendicitis Diagnosis and Management (14 papers), Bariatric Surgery and Outcomes (12 papers), Gallbladder and Bile Duct Disorders (11 papers), Esophageal and GI Pathology (9 papers), Gastric Cancer Management and Outcomes (8 papers), Pancreatitis Pathology and Treatment (6 papers), Abdominal Surgery and Complications (6 papers) and Biliary and Gastrointestinal Fistulas (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Emergency Medicine (451 citations), Surgery (995 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(507 citations), Gastroenterology (45 citations) and Oncology (207 citations). Benoı̂t Navez has collaborated with scholars based in Belgium, France and United States. Frequent co-authors include Pierre Guiot, Emmanuel Cambier, Julie Navez, G Champault, Eléonore Maury, Jacques Marescaux, Didier Mutter, Ferdinando Agresta, Roberto Bergamaschi and S. Saad. Their work appears in journals such as Surgical Endoscopy, Obesity Surgery, Surgical Laparoscopy Endoscopy & Percutaneous Techniques, World Journal of Surgery and The American Surgeon.
